S.Res.No. 40
RECOGNIZING APRIL AS SEXUAL ASSAULT AWARENESS MONTH AND APRIL 24, 2024, AS DENIM DAY
A Resolution recognizing April as Sexual Assault Awareness Month and April 24, 2024, as Denim Day; supporting Peace Over Violence and the YWCA; and directing distribution.
WHEREAS, April is nationally recognized as Sexual Assault Awareness Month and the Peace Over Violence organization has declared April 24, 2024, as Denim Day. Both events draw attention to the misconceptions and misinformation about sexual violence, which remains a serious issue in our society; and
WHEREAS, sexual harassment is part of a continuum of violence with damaging effects that are felt throughout our culture. Harmful attitudes about all forms of sexual violence allow these issues to persist and allow victims and survivors to be revictimized; and
WHEREAS, every sixty-eight seconds an American is sexually assaulted and approximately one in six women is raped during her lifetime; and
WHEREAS, in Oklahoma, the rate of rape and attempted rape among females reported to law enforcement has been 35–45% higher than the United States rate for the past decade; and
WHEREAS, Oklahoma law enforcement reported 2,245 forcible and attempted rapes in 2020—which represented 12.5% of all violent crimes—and reported rape cases have increased 21% over the past three years, and 34.2% overall since 2013; and
WHEREAS, youth under eighteen years old account for about 44% of all reported sexual assaults, at least 25% of women experience sexual harassment in the workplace, and about 75% of sexual harassment victims experience retaliation when they report it; and
WHEREAS, sexual violence and its unfair and traumatizing effects are preventable with proper education on the matter and comprehensive prevention projects; and
WHEREAS, members of the Oklahoma State Senate strongly support the efforts of Peace Over Violence and the YWCA to educate persons in our state about the true impact of sexual harassment, abuse, assault, and rape.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E SENATE OF THE 2ND SESSION OF THE 59TH OKLAHOMA LEGISLATURE:
THAT the Oklahoma State Senate recognizes the month of April as Sexual Assault Awareness Month.
THAT the Oklahoma State Senate designates April 24, 2024, as Denim Day and urges everyone to wear jeans on this day to help communicate the message that there is no excuse and there is never an invitation to harass, abuse, assault, or rape.
THAT a copy of this resolution be distributed to the YWCA.
Adopted by the Senate the 24th day of April, 2024.
